Abstract

Methyl tert-butyl ether of high purity is prepared by reacting methanol with isobutylene in the presence of an acid ion exchange resin in two stages by feeding methanol and isobutylene mixed with other hydrocarbons to the respective members of a pair of interconnected reactors so that the quantity of alcohol present in one of the reactors is in excess of the stoichiometric equivalent of the quantity of isobutylene therein, while the quantity of isobutylene present in the other reactor is in excess of the stoichiometric equivalent of the quantity of methanol therein, and the methyl tert-butyl ether so formed is recovered through distillation.
